6. Toby Jones

Dobby Toby Jones
Warner Bros/BBC

Part of what makes Dobby the House Elf so adorable (and initially so annoying, actually) is the vocal performance that goes along with his slightly goofy look. He has the soft voice of someone who has never been allowed to speak up, who has suffered unspeakably and who is almost ashamed of what he is when he has to talk to others.

Think of the heart-breaking delivery of his final lines ("Such a beautiful place. . . to be with friends. Dobby is happy to be with his friend. . . Harry Potter"), and it's almost impossible to think of him sounding any other way than the way he's captured there.

That performance comes courtesy of British star Toby Jones, known for playing Culverton Smith in Sherlock, Dr. Arnim Zola in the MCU and Claudius Templesmith in The Hunger Games (among many, many other roles). Again, he does such a good job disguising his voice that it's basically impossible to know it's him without looking it up.
